- Michelle Obama opened by paying tribute to Barack Obama, saying she wanted to “fully sing his praises” at the presidential center grand opening in Chicago, saying, “Eight years in the crucible, and not once did you melt from the heat. Not once did you let it harden you.”
- She referenced criticism and conspiracy theories Barack faced during his time in office, including false claims about his birthplace, faith and patriotism.
- Michelle praised her husband's composure amid attacks, saying, "You were unflappable at every turn, always focused, always calm and always looking at the long view.”
- She also reflected on their life together, recalling a promise he made early in their relationship: “You told me all those years ago that you couldn’t promise me the world, but you could promise me an interesting life ... and managed to give me both.”
- Closing her speech, she said: “How absurd it is to imagine that you would do anything but make our family and this entire country proud.”
